Bortniansky: Cherubic Hymn, No. 7

Dmitri Bortniansky was born in the Ukraine, then part of the Russian Empire. His considerable talent soon took him to the Imperial Chapel where at the age of seven he began to sing and study music and composition. His master and the current director of the chapel choir, was an Italian, Baldassare Galuppi, who had been brought to Russia on the request of Catherine the Great.
